Position Summary
The Buyer is responsible for purchasing bicycle products for the company’s ecommerce platform, balancing inventory health, vendor relationships, and business goals. This role combines day-to-day execution of purchase orders with ongoing evaluation of inventory performance, pricing actions, and supplier collaboration.
The Buyer is expected to apply judgment, challenge assumptions, and make data-informed recommendations that improve inventory efficiency, margin, and product availability.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Purchasing & Purchase Order Execution
-
Create, review, and submit purchase orders to manufacturers and suppliers to support inventory needs.
-
Maintain accuracy of purchase orders, including quantities, costs, lead times, and delivery expectations.
-
Monitor open purchase orders and follow up with suppliers as needed to ensure timely fulfillment.
-
Participate in ongoing improvements to purchasing workflows with the goal of reducing manual effort over time.
Inventory Evaluation & Decision-Making
-
Regularly evaluate inventory performance, including identifying strong-performing products and slow or at-risk inventory.
-
Use inventory data to inform purchasing decisions, recommend adjustments, and prevent overbuy situations.
-
Challenge assumptions around replenishment, forecasting, and buy quantities when data suggests risk or opportunity.
-
Partner internally to recommend corrective actions such as promotions, markdowns, or reduced future buys.
Pricing & Promotional Support
-
Adjust pricing as needed to support inventory health, promotions, and business goals.
-
Place products on special or adjust listing prices based on inventory position, seasonality, or strategic direction.
-
Monitor and maintain compliance with brand MAP policies.
-
Identify opportunities where pricing or promotional activity could improve sell-through.
Vendor & Brand Management
-
Serve as a primary point of contact for assigned brands and suppliers.
-
Communicate purchasing plans, inventory needs, and concerns clearly and professionally.
-
Maintain strong working relationships with suppliers while advocating for the company’s business needs.
-
Surface issues or opportunities related to supply, cost changes, availability, or product lifecycle.
Cross-Functional Collaboration
-
Communicate relevant product, inventory, and purchasing information to internal teams to support accurate listings, customer experience, and operational planning.
-
Partner with Copywriting to provide product details and context, particularly for new product introductions.
-
Support Customer Service by supplying product information and availability details.
-
Coordinate with Invoicing as needed to resolve questions related to purchase orders, costs, or supplier billing.
-
Communicate proactively with Distribution Center leads to provide visibility into inbound inventory, especially for larger or time-sensitive orders.
-
Collaborate with internal stakeholders to align purchasing decisions with broader business objectives.
Data & Tools
-
Use Excel regularly to support inventory evaluation and purchasing decisions.
-
Maintain accurate records and documentation related to purchasing and inventory activities.
-
Continuously build comfort and proficiency with tools and systems used to support buying decisions.
